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building’s main structure, specifically within the crawlspace area.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ation and substructure, identifying problems such as sagging or uneven floors, and impl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Common methods include installing or replacing support beams, piers, or braces, as well as sealing and insulating the crawlspace to prevent future damage. The goal is to restore structural integrity and improve the overall stability of the property.
Problems that crawlspace foundation repair services help solve often stem from settling, shifting soil, moisture intrusion, or poor drainage. These issues can lead to foundation cracks, uneven flooring, and increased vulnerability to further structural damage. Moisture problems within the crawlspace may also cause mold growth and wood rot, which can compromise the building’s stability and indoor air quality. Repair services aim to correct these issues by providing a stable foundation, controlling moisture levels, and preventing future deterioration.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for crawlspace foundation repair services range from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of damage and required work. For example, minor repairs might cost around $1,500, while more extensive foundation stabilization can reach $5,000 or more.
Labor and Materials - The cost of labor and materials usually accounts for a significant portion of the total repair expenses, often between $500 and $2,500. The price varies based on the size of the crawlspace and the complexity of the repair process.
Structural Reinforcement - Reinforcing or replacing foundation supports typically costs between $2,000 and $7,000. Larger or more severe issues, such as extensive settling, may push costs higher depending on the scope of work.
Additional Services - Services like moisture control or insulation upgrades can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. These enhancements are often recommended to improve crawlspace stability and prevent future iss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ls or floors, musty odors, and pest infestations.
How can crawlspace foundation problems be repaired? Local service providers typically offer solutions such as underpinning, sealing, and installing supports to stabilize the foundation.
Is crawlspace repair necessary for my home’s safety? If there are signs of structural damage or moisture problems, contacting a professional for assessment and repair is recommended.
What causes crawlspace foundation damage? Causes include soil movement, moisture intrusion, poor drainage, and inadequate support systems.
